We are supporting our client to identify a Change and Org Design Partner to provide end to end support for business remodelling and restructuring, keeping customers central and ensuring employee engagement to drive successful people change. The role is based onsite one day per week, based in Cardiff.

Key Activities:

Manage light touch project work for remodelling and restructuring from both HR Services and business perspectives, ensuring project outcomes.
Support business in developing change strategies, rationale, and implementation phases.
Ensure legal and commercial robustness of change rationales for consultation documentation.
Collaborate with senior leadership and HR Services Executives to deliver change across business areas.
Challenge remodelling proposals, considering costs, structure, skills, and risks.
Promote employee engagement during restructuring and implement processes to mitigate risks.
Develop communication strategies for remodelling and support skills development post change.
Manage employee consultations, ensuring legal compliance and understanding.
Quickly integrate into the business area as a Change Partner, attending relevant meetings.
Build trusted relationships with business heads for early engagement in change management.
Understand commercial strategies to tailor change management support for the future.
Provide coaching and challenge to managers on people practices, minimising risk during change.
Lead best practices in dealing with challenging situations.
Coordinate change integration with HR Services Executives and remain the subject matter expert post-change.

The Candidate:

Proven track record in change management, project management, and TUPE/M&A.
Extensive experience in both collective and individual consultations.
Ability to challenge legal counsel on consultation documentation and processes.
Strong interpersonal and communication skills, approachable and diplomatic.
Solutions-focused with a flexible approach.
Able to work independently and as part of a team, with strong organisational skills.
Demonstrates personal and professional credibility.
